Warning signs posted as Portuguese Man o’ War wash ashore

Ocean Safety officials have posted warning signs in the Ala Moana and Waikiki Beach areas after an influx of Portuguese Man o’ War washed ashore Monday morning.

Ocean Safety officials did not have an exact count of how many Man o’ War were found, but did say as of about 9:30 a.m., two stings had been reported in Waikiki.

Man o’ War can cause painful stings similar to jellyfish, but their blue color makes them hard to spot in the water.
